1[
2  {
3    "Object_name": "fi.w1.wpa_supplicant1",
4    "interfaces": [
5      {
6        "interface": "fi.w1.wpa_supplicant1",
7        "methods": [],
8        "properties": [
9          "DebugLevel (Set,Get)",
10          "DebugShowKeys (Set,Get)",
11          "DebugTimestamp (Set,Get)",
12          "EapMethods (Set,Get)",
13          "Interfaces (Set,Get)"
14        ],
15        "signals": [
16          "InterfaceAdded",
17          "InterfaceRemoved",
18          "PropertiesChanged"
19        ]
20      },
21      {
22        "interface": "fi.w1.wpa_supplicant1.BSS",
23        "methods": [],
24        "properties": [
25          "BSSID (Set,Get)",
26          "Frequency (Set,Get)",
27          "IEs (Set,Get)",
28          "Mode (Set,Get)",
29          "Privacy (Set,Get)",
30          "RSN (Set,Get)",
31          "Rates (Set,Get)",
32          "SSID (Set,Get)",
33          "Signal (Set,Get)",
34          "WPA (Set,Get)"
35        ],
36        "signals": [
37          "PropertiesChanged"
38        ]
39      },
40      {
41        "interface": "fi.w1.wpa_supplicant1.Interface",
42        "methods": [],
43        "properties": [
44          "ApScan (Set,Get)",
45          "BSSExpireAge (Set,Get)",
46          "BSSExpireCount (Set,Get)",
47          "BSSs (Set,Get)",
48          "Blobs (Set,Get)",
49          "BridgeIfname (Set,Get)",
50          "Capabilities (Set,Get)",
51          "Country (Set,Get)",
52          "CurrentAuthMode (Set,Get)",
53          "CurrentBSS (Set,Get)",
54          "CurrentNetwork (Set,Get)",
55          "Driver (Set,Get)",
56          "Ifname (Set,Get)",
57          "Networks (Set,Get)",
58          "Scanning (Set,Get)",
59          "State (Set,Get)"
60        ],
61        "signals": [
62          "BSSAdded",
63          "BSSRemoved",
64          "BlobAdded",
65          "BlobRemoved",
66          "NetworkAdded",
67          "NetworkRemoved",
68          "NetworkSelected",
69          "PropertiesChanged",
70          "ScanDone"
71        ]
72      },
73      {
74        "interface": "org.freedesktop.DBus.Properties",
75        "methods": [
76          "Get",
77          "GetAll",
78          "Set"
79        ],
80        "properties": [],
81        "signals": []
82      }
83    ]
84  },
85  {
86    "Object_name": "org.chromium.Cashew",
87    "interfaces": [
88      {
89        "interface": "org.chromium.Cashew",
90        "methods": [
91          "GetDataPlans",
92          "IsAlive",
93          "RequestCellularUsageInfo",
94          "RequestDataPlansUpdate"
95        ],
96        "properties": [],
97        "signals": [
98          "DataPlansUpdate"
99        ]
100      },
101      {
102        "interface": "org.freedesktop.DBus.Introspectable",
103        "methods": [
104          "Introspect"
105        ],
106        "properties": [],
107        "signals": []
108      }
109    ]
110  },
111  {
112    "Object_name": "org.chromium.CrosDisks",
113    "interfaces": [
114      {
115        "interface": "org.chromium.CrosDisks",
116        "methods": [
117          "EnumerateAutoMountableDevices",
118          "EnumerateDevices",
119          "FilesystemMount",
120          "FilesystemUnmount",
121          "FormatDevice",
122          "GetDeviceFilesystem",
123          "GetDeviceProperties",
124          "IsAlive",
125          "Mount",
126          "Unmount"
127        ],
128        "signals": [
129          "DeviceAdded",
130          "DeviceRemoved",
131          "DeviceScanned",
132          "DiskAdded",
133          "DiskChanged",
134          "DiskRemoved",
135          "FormattingFinished",
136          "MountCompleted"
137        ]
138      },
139      {
140        "interface": "org.freedesktop.DBus.Introspectable",
141        "methods": [
142          "Introspect"
143        ],
144        "properties": [],
145        "signals": []
146      },
147      {
148        "interface": "org.freedesktop.DBus.Properties",
149        "methods": [
150          "Get",
151          "GetAll",
152          "Set"
153        ],
154        "properties": [],
155        "signals": []
156      }
157    ]
158  },
159  {
160    "Object_name": "org.chromium.Cryptohome",
161    "interfaces": [
162      {
163        "interface": "org.chromium.CryptohomeInterface",
164        "methods": [
165          "AsyncCheckKey",
166          "AsyncDoAutomaticFreeDiskSpaceControl",
167          "AsyncMigrateKey",
168          "AsyncMount",
169          "AsyncMountGuest",
170          "AsyncRemove",
171          "AsyncRemoveTrackedSubdirectories",
172          "AsyncSetOwnerUser",
173          "AsyncUpdateCurrentUserActivityTimestamp",
174          "CheckKey",
175          "DoAutomaticFreeDiskSpaceControl",
176          "GetStatusString",
177          "GetSystemSalt",
178          "InstallAttributesCount",
179          "InstallAttributesFinalize",
180          "InstallAttributesGet",
181          "InstallAttributesIsFirstInstall",
182          "InstallAttributesIsInvalid",
183          "InstallAttributesIsReady",
184          "InstallAttributesIsSecure",
185          "InstallAttributesSet",
186          "IsMounted",
187          "MigrateKey",
188          "Mount",
189          "MountGuest",
190          "Pkcs11GetTpmTokenInfo",
191          "Pkcs11IsTpmTokenReady",
192          "Remove",
193          "RemoveTrackedSubdirectories",
194          "TpmCanAttemptOwnership",
195          "TpmClearStoredPassword",
196          "TpmGetPassword",
197          "TpmIsBeingOwned",
198          "TpmIsEnabled",
199          "TpmIsOwned",
200          "TpmIsReady",
201          "Unmount"
202        ],
203        "properties": [],
204        "signals": [
205          "AsyncCallStatus",
206          "TpmInitStatus"
207        ]
208      }
209    ]
210  },
211  {
212    "Object_name": "org.chromium.LibCrosService",
213    "interfaces": [
214      {
215        "interface": "org.chromium.LibCrosServiceInterface",
216        "methods": [
217          "ResolveNetworkProxy"
218        ],
219        "properties": [],
220        "signals": []
221      },
222      {
223        "interface": "org.freedesktop.DBus.Introspectable",
224        "methods": [
225          "Introspect"
226        ],
227        "properties": [],
228        "signals": []
229      },
230      {
231        "interface": "org.freedesktop.DBus.Properties",
232        "methods": [
233          "Get",
234          "GetAll",
235          "Set"
236        ],
237        "properties": [],
238        "signals": []
239      }
240    ]
241  },
242  {
243    "Object_name": "org.chromium.ModemManager",
244    "interfaces": [
245      {
246        "interface": "org.chromium.ModemManager.Modem.Gobi",
247        "methods": [
248          "SetCarrier"
249        ],
250        "properties": [],
251        "signals": [
252          "DormancyStatus"
253        ]
254      },
255      {
256        "interface": "org.freedesktop.DBus.Properties",
257        "methods": [
258          "Get",
259          "GetAll",
260          "Set"
261        ],
262        "properties": [],
263        "signals": []
264      },
265      {
266        "interface": "org.freedesktop.ModemManager",
267        "methods": [
268          "EnumerateDevices"
269        ],
270        "properties": [],
271        "signals": [
272          "DeviceAdded",
273          "DeviceRemoved"
274        ]
275      },
276      {
277        "interface": "org.freedesktop.ModemManager.Modem",
278        "methods": [
279          "Connect",
280          "FactoryReset",
281          "GetInfo"
282        ],
283        "properties": [
284          "Device (Set,Get)",
285          "Driver (Set,Get)",
286          "Enabled (Set,Get)",
287          "IpMethod (Set,Get)",
288          "MasterDevice (Set,Get)",
289          "State (Set,Get)",
290          "Type (Set,Get)",
291          "UnlockRequired (Set,Get)",
292          "UnlockRetries (Set,Get)"
293        ],
294        "signals": [
295          "StateChanged"
296        ]
297      },
298      {
299        "interface": "org.freedesktop.ModemManager.Modem.Cdma",
300        "methods": [
301          "Activate",
302          "ActivateManualDebug",
303          "GetEsn",
304          "GetRegistrationState",
305          "GetServingSystem",
306          "GetSignalQuality"
307        ],
308        "properties": [
309          "Meid (Set,Get)"
310        ],
311        "signals": [
312          "ActivationStateChanged",
313          "RegistrationStateChanged",
314          "SignalQuality"
315        ]
316      },
317      {
318        "interface": "org.freedesktop.ModemManager.Modem.Simple",
319        "methods": [
320          "GetStatus"
321        ],
322        "properties": [],
323        "signals": []
324      }
325    ]
326  },
327  {
328    "Object_name": "org.chromium.PowerManager",
329    "interfaces": [
330      {
331        "interface": "org.chromium.PowerManager",
332        "methods": [
333          "DecreaseScreenBrightness",
334          "IncreaseScreenBrightness"
335        ],
336        "properties": [],
337        "signals": []
338      },
339      {
340        "interface": "org.freedesktop.DBus.Introspectable",
341        "methods": [
342          "Introspect"
343        ],
344        "properties": [],
345        "signals": []
346      },
347      {
348        "interface": "org.freedesktop.DBus.Properties",
349        "methods": [
350          "Get",
351          "GetAll",
352          "Set"
353        ],
354        "properties": [],
355        "signals": []
356      }
357    ]
358  },
359  {
360    "Object_name": "org.chromium.SessionManager",
361    "interfaces": [
362      {
363        "interface": "org.chromium.SessionManagerInterface",
364        "methods": [
365          "CheckWhitelist",
366          "EmitLoginPromptReady",
367          "EmitLoginPromptVisible",
368          "EnumerateWhitelisted",
369          "LockScreen",
370          "RestartEntd",
371          "RestartJob",
372          "RetrievePolicy",
373          "RetrieveProperty",
374          "RetrieveSessionState",
375          "SetOwnerKey",
376          "StartSession",
377          "StopSession",
378          "StorePolicy",
379          "StoreProperty",
380          "UnlockScreen",
381          "Unwhitelist",
382          "Whitelist"
383        ],
384        "properties": [],
385        "signals": [
386          "SessionStateChanged"
387        ]
388      }
389    ]
390  },
391  {
392    "Object_name": "org.chromium.UpdateEngine",
393    "interfaces": [
394      {
395        "interface": "org.chromium.UpdateEngineInterface",
396        "methods": [
397          "AttemptUpdate",
398          "GetStatus",
399          "GetTrack",
400          "RebootIfNeeded",
401          "SetTrack"
402        ],
403        "properties": [],
404        "signals": [
405          "StatusUpdate"
406        ]
407      }
408    ]
409  },
410  {
411    "Object_name": "org.chromium.flimflam",
412    "interfaces": [
413      {
414        "interface": "org.chromium.flimflam.Device",
415        "methods": [
416          "AddIPConfig",
417          "ChangePin",
418          "ClearProperty",
419          "EnterPin",
420          "GetProperties",
421          "ProposeScan",
422          "Register",
423          "RequirePin",
424          "SetProperty",
425          "UnblockPin"
426        ],
427        "properties": [],
428        "signals": [
429          "PropertyChanged"
430        ]
431      },
432      {
433        "interface": "org.chromium.flimflam.IPConfig",
434        "methods": [
435          "ClearProperty",
436          "GetProperties",
437          "MoveAfter",
438          "MoveBefore",
439          "Remove",
440          "SetProperty"
441        ],
442        "properties": [],
443        "signals": [
444          "PropertyChanged"
445        ]
446      },
447      {
448        "interface": "org.chromium.flimflam.Manager",
449        "methods": [
450          "ConfigureWifiService",
451          "CreateProfile",
452          "DisableTechnology",
453          "EnableTechnology",
454          "GetDebugMask",
455          "GetDebugTags",
456          "GetProperties",
457          "GetService",
458          "GetServiceOrder",
459          "GetState",
460          "GetVPNService",
461          "GetWifiService",
462          "ListDebugTags",
463          "PopAnyProfile",
464          "PopProfile",
465          "PushProfile",
466          "RegisterAgent",
467          "RemoveProfile",
468          "RequestScan",
469          "SetDebugMask",
470          "SetDebugTags",
471          "SetProperty",
472          "SetServiceOrder",
473          "UnregisterAgent"
474        ],
475        "properties": [],
476        "signals": [
477          "PropertyChanged",
478          "StateChanged"
479        ]
480      },
481      {
482        "interface": "org.chromium.flimflam.Network",
483        "methods": [
484          "GetProperties"
485        ],
486        "properties": [],
487        "signals": [
488          "PropertyChanged"
489        ]
490      },
491      {
492        "interface": "org.chromium.flimflam.Profile",
493        "methods": [
494          "DeleteEntry",
495          "GetEntry",
496          "GetProperties",
497          "SetProperty"
498        ],
499        "properties": [],
500        "signals": [
501          "PropertyChanged"
502        ]
503      },
504      {
505        "interface": "org.chromium.flimflam.Service",
506        "methods": [
507          "ActivateCellularModem",
508          "ClearProperty",
509          "Connect",
510          "Disconnect",
511          "GetProperties",
512          "MoveAfter",
513          "MoveBefore",
514          "Remove",
515          "SetProperty"
516        ],
517        "properties": [],
518        "signals": [
519          "PropertyChanged"
520        ]
521      }
522    ]
523  },
524  {
525    "Object_name": "org.freedesktop.DBus",
526    "interfaces": [
527      {
528        "interface": "org.freedesktop.DBus",
529        "methods": [],
530        "properties": [],
531        "signals": [
532          "NameAcquired",
533          "NameLost",
534          "NameOwnerChanged"
535        ]
536      }
537    ]
538  },
539  {
540    "Object_name": "org.freedesktop.ModemManager",
541    "interfaces": [
542      {
543        "interface": "org.freedesktop.DBus.Properties",
544        "methods": [
545          "Get",
546          "GetAll",
547          "Set"
548        ],
549        "properties": [],
550        "signals": []
551      },
552      {
553        "interface": "org.freedesktop.ModemManager",
554        "methods": [
555          "EnumerateDevices",
556          "SetLogging"
557        ],
558        "properties": [],
559        "signals": [
560          "DeviceAdded",
561          "DeviceRemoved"
562        ]
563      }
564    ]
565  }
566]
567